Q: Is 21,010,535 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 21,010,535 is not a prime number.

Why is 21,010,535 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 21010535 can be evenly divided by 1 5 7 13 35 61 65 91 305 427 455 757 793 2,135 3,785 3,965 5,299 5,551 9,841 26,495 27,755 46,177 49,205 68,887 230,885 323,239 344,435 600,301 1,616,195 3,001,505 4,202,107 and 21,010,535, with no remainder.

Since 21,010,535 cannot be divided by just 1 and 21,010,535, it is not a prime number.
